Chris McGinlay

First appearance: Episode 3

Chris McGinlay is a secondary school teacher in the UK, variously teaching physics, mathematics, computing and robotics at junior high school level for around twenty years.

In his spare time he enjoys software development, particularly with Python and Django, using automated deployment and test-driven development in the ongoing production of www.eduduck.com.

He also enjoys dabbling with the Arduino microcontroller, is a long-time user of GNU/Linux (Gentoo, Ubuntu) and recently survived his first ever one-hour long game of squash (with only minor injuries sustained).

For a complete change of scenery, Chris will spend a good deal of his spare time boating, fishing and visiting small islands in his restored Shetland Model fourareen.
